How to plant passion fruit seeds and how to raise seedlings

1. How to plant passion fruit seeds

1. Prepare seeds: First prepare some healthy and plump passion fruit seeds and wash them in clean water. Then soak them in clean water at 20-30℃ for about 5 hours to soften the seed coat. Then, wrap them in wet paper towels and place them in a dark environment with a temperature between 25-32℃, and wait for them to turn white.

2. Prepare materials: Planting passion fruit seeds requires loose, breathable and fertile soil. Planting soil can be prepared by mixing garden soil and river sand. After preparing the soil, place them in the sun for disinfection.

3. Planting: Put the soil that has been exposed to the sun and disinfected into a seedling container with good permeability and level the soil surface. Then place the white seeds on the soil surface and cover them with a thin layer of sand to prevent them from being blown away by the wind.

4. Later maintenance: After sowing, place them in a warm environment of about 25℃, spray water into the soil in time to maintain humidity, and wait for them to germinate. Generally speaking, if the environment is suitable, they will germinate within a week.

2. How to grow passion fruit seedlings

When cultivating passion fruit seedlings, place them in a warm place with a temperature of about 25°C. During the cultivation period, keep it ventilated, keep warm, and spray water from time to time to allow it to receive light, but if the sun is very strong, it needs to be shaded to prevent it from being sunburned. Newly sprouted seedlings do not need fertilizer. Wait until its root system has initially grown before applying fertilizer.
